It is clear that some chemicals can damage the health of animals and humans. However, this is not the only problem that can be caused by the careless use of chemicals. Chemicals can also disturb the ecological balance of the environment. If the ecological balance is disturbed, the consequences can be extremely serious.
The history of DDT illustrates the problem. DDT, a chemical which kills insects, at first seemed to be a perfect answer to many problems. It would control insects that caused billions of dollars of damage to crops every year. Governments permitted and encouraged the use of DDT. Farmers in many countries began to spray it on their crops. The immediate results were good: damage to crops went down, and profits went up. However, the chemical had effects which the scientists did not predict. First, it also killed insects which were the natural enemies of the harmful insects and which were therefore beneficial to farmers. Second, and perhaps worse, DDT did not kill every harmful insect. A few insects had natural resistance to the chemical. They survived and multiplied. In a few years there were large numbers of insects which were not affected by DDT, and there were fewer insects which could act as natural controls on these new "super-insects". Finally, it became clear that DDT was not solving the insect problem. In fact, it was making the problem worse. It then became necessary to find a second cure for the effects of the first.
